  • 👋 Hi, I’m Patrizia Favaron (@mafavaron)
  • 👀 I’m interested in the physics of lower atmosphere and, as developer, in building measurement systems dedicated to the environment and building environmental data processing libraries and applications.
  • 🌱 I’m currently learning the language Julia, advanced use of modern Fortran, and of course, more physics.
  • 💞️ I’m looking to collaborate on environmental data processing projects, with a special attention to micro-meteorology and micro-climatology.
